This case study examines important changes known to be either in the system or being considered at this time. Many aspects of the Egyptian energy sector are currently in the process of changing or change has been proposed. This includes, inter alia, elements relating to the costs of electricity transmission and distribution; new laws relating to the incorporation of wind power; pricing of gas, electricity and other energy carriers; whether wind components will be constructed in Egypt and how new wind plants will be tendered. Progress in a number of areas is expected in the second half of 2009, though the precise dates and impacts of these changes exhibit significant uncertainty.
